For two data sets, each with size 5 , the variances are given to be 3 and 4 and the corresponding means are given to be 2 and 4 , respectively. The variance of the combined data set is

Options

  1. A11 2
  2. B9 2
  3. C13 2
  4. D5 2

Correct answer

B. 9 2

Step-by-step solution

σ x 2 = 3 σ y 2 = 4 x ¯ = 2 y ¯ = 4 Σ x i 5 = 2 ⇒ Σ x i = 10 ; Σ y i = 20 ; σ x 2 = 1 5 ∑ x i 2 − x ¯ 2 ⇒ 1 5 ∑ x i 2 − 4 = 3 ∑ x i 2 = 35 ∑ y i 2 = 100 σ z 2 = 1 10 ∑ x i 2 + ∑ y i 2 − x ¯ + y ¯ 2 2 = 1 10 35 + 100 - 9 = 135 - 90 10 = 45 10 = 9 2
